Transaction 68b3f2980f6ac9fe4c51bae18f9e8bfbd1f61c8af2febab5aa95c9ade416e14f

8 Input
2 Outputs
  • 68b3f2980f6ac9fe4c51bae18f9e8bfbd1f61c8af2febab5aa95c9ade416e14f:0
  • value  12712689477
    address  3EpMfJXTVAiaG5eXorUdnVKfWDCCgDHaNS
  • 68b3f2980f6ac9fe4c51bae18f9e8bfbd1f61c8af2febab5aa95c9ade416e14f:1
  • value  1709707758
    address  37zCmWBXiRVvdp6c6Fffhi3pxJ5dmkNFQF